Animal Control Technicians - This is a rewarding job, especially for those who enjoy the outdoors. Animal Control Technicians keep animals and the environment safe and free of disease. These technicians usually work in an animal shelter. They are responsible for a wide range of duties including animal care, monitoring and health, as well as ensuring animals are properly treated.

Veterinarians. These vets are experts at animal medicine and can be trusted to treat all types of animals. Some vets specialize in companion animals, while others are specialized in treating large or exotic animals. Wildlife Conservationists: Wildlife conservationists study the impact of human activity on the natural world. These professionals are responsible for conducting research and writing reports on habitats, and the animals that live within them. They work in collaboration with other professionals to improve these ecosystems.


Animal Trainers. Most animal trainers work only with dogs. However, they are also able to work with exotic and non-domestic animals. Animal trainers typically teach animals how commands work and what to do. They are also responsible in maintaining good relations with patrons and educating people.

Shelter veterinarians: These veterinarians work in shelters and veterinary hospitals to treat sick or injured animals. Typically, these professionals will administer heartworm prevention, flea prevention, physical examinations, and other tests. A shelter veterinarian will also inform the public about animal health issues and preventative actions.

Animal Care Technicians: An Animal Care Technician is responsible for day-to-day animal care, feeding, and interacting with the public. A majority of animal care technicians will hold a bachelor’s degree. Animal care technicians have to clean, repair, and maintain animal kennels.
